President Trump Will Nominate Lee Zeldin to Lead the Environmental Protection Agency, EPA

Announcing via Truth Social, President Trump has outlined his selection for Administrator of the Environmental Protection Agency in term-2.

President Trump announced his intent to nominate former New York Congressman, Lee Zeldin, to the position.

[Source]

Lee Zeldin is an attorney, and his announced nomination caught the DC proletariat off-guard.  The announcement is an unusually prominent location in the line-up presentation given the generally obscure nature of the agency.   Deregulation appears to be a significant agenda item in the T-2 administration.

Washington DC – […] The selection of Zeldin, a vocal Trump ally in Congress during his first term, was a surprise after Andrew Wheeler, who served as the second EPA chief during Trump’s first term, was widely thought to be the frontrunner for the post.

At EPA, Zeldin will carry out Trump’s energy and environmental agenda, which includes pulling back Biden-era rules on climate and air pollution and potentially rescinding millions of dollars in funding for clean energy under the Inflation Reduction Act. And the administration is expected to take a more aggressive stance in challenging California’s autonomy in enforcing environmental standards that are more stringent than those set by the federal government — many of which picked up as models for more than a dozen other blue states.

A recess appointment is an appointment, by the President of the United States, of a senior federal official to fill a vacant position while the United States Senate is in recess.

Recess appointments are authorized by Article II, Section 2 of the U.S. Constitution, which states: “The President shall have Power to fill up all Vacancies that may happen during the Recess of the Senate, by granting Commissions which shall expire at the End of their next Session.”
